2204895 - Error: 14622, Severity: 20, State: 1 - what does it mean and how to fix in ASE/REP ?

Symptom

  • When rebooting a server the following error is seen:

Error: 14622, Severity: 20, State: 1
The dbinfo anchor in the database 'database 'MYDB' (87)' is already locked by the task. Nested access to dbinfo anchor is not allowed. This is an internal error. Please contact Sybase Technical Support.

  • What does it mean? 
  • And what can be done to recover?
